Output 4e8e59863f9e02586f93e9446f6ff1cb12dc2384ed73f4834f47f641d94bddca:23

value
579815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d81e28a1fbacd9b53ad9f913f08eb755ba44b935 OP_EQUAL
address
3MPk1ShLWjPrbs3q4fZdmSd4552vWCZJfS
transaction
4e8e59863f9e02586f93e9446f6ff1cb12dc2384ed73f4834f47f641d94bddca
confirmations
143208
spent
true